U.S. Department of Transportation Media Planner Salaries in Boulder

The average U.S. Department of Transportation Media Planner in Boulder earns an estimated $64,138 annually. U.S. Department of Transportation's Media Planner compensation is $3,894 more than the US average for a Media Planner.

In Boulder, The Marketing Department at U.S. Department of Transportation earns $7,721 more on average than the Sales Department.

Media Planner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Media Planner at companies similar size to U.S. Department of Transportation reported making $70,433, while the average male Media Planner at similar sized companies reported making $75,000.

Media Planner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Media Planner at companies similar size to U.S. Department of Transportation reported making $73,250, while the average Asian or Pacific Islander Media Planner at similar sized companies reported making $57,750.

How Media Planners at U.S. Department of Transportation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Media Planners at U.S. Department of Transportation believe they're not compensated fairly. 67% of Media Planners at U.S. Department of Transportation say they receive annual bonuses, and the vast majority (75%) are satisfied with their benefits.
